首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

i2c多个内部地址?

I2C(Inter-Integrated Circuit)是一种串行通信协议,用于连接微控制器和外部设备。它允许多个设备通过共享同一条总线进行通信。

在I2C总线上,每个设备都有一个唯一的7位或10位地址,用于识别设备。这些地址可以分为两类:内部地址和外部地址。

内部地址是指设备内部的寄存器地址,用于访问设备内部的不同功能或配置。通过在I2C总线上发送设备地址,然后发送内部地址,可以选择性地读取或写入设备内部的特定寄存器。

对于具有多个内部地址的设备,可以通过在内部地址字段中指定不同的地址来选择要访问的寄存器。这样,可以通过单个设备地址访问设备的不同功能或配置。

I2C多个内部地址的应用场景非常广泛。例如,传感器设备通常具有多个内部寄存器,用于配置传感器的工作模式、采样率等参数。通过使用不同的内部地址,可以方便地访问和配置传感器的各个寄存器。

腾讯云提供了一系列与I2C相关的产品和服务,例如:

  1. 物联网通信(IoT Hub):提供了可靠的设备连接和管理功能,支持I2C等多种通信协议。
  2. 物联网开发套件(IoT Explorer):提供了设备管理、数据采集、规则引擎等功能,可用于构建物联网应用。
  3. 边缘计算(Cloud Edge):提供了在边缘设备上运行应用程序的能力,可与I2C设备进行通信和交互。

通过使用这些腾讯云的产品和服务,开发者可以更轻松地构建和管理基于I2C通信的物联网应用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券